Commit graph

1862 commits

Author SHA1 Message Date
David Rowe
cb4bd58381 Load controller scripts in their own script engine 2017-03-15 14:31:13 +13:00
Seth Alves
524e4bdfbc Merge pull request #9853 from sethalves/tablet-ui-fix-edit-props-race
Tablet ui fix edit props race
2017-03-13 08:56:56 -08:00
Anthony J. Thibault
3abc78e7d3 Fix for finger/sytlus on invisible/hidden tablet. 2017-03-10 17:18:13 -08:00
Anthony J. Thibault
07e10ae862 Merge branch 'tablet-ui' into feature/can-touch-this 2017-03-10 17:05:26 -08:00
Seth Alves
2098cd5b5e remove stylus and search-beams when grab script is shut down 2017-03-10 13:02:16 -08:00
Seth Alves
88e74251a1 cleanups 2017-03-10 12:51:34 -08:00
Seth Alves
411ec9a791 Merge branch 'tablet-ui' of github.com:highfidelity/hifi into tablet-ui-fix-edit-props-race 2017-03-10 10:22:10 -08:00
Seth Alves
fffff817a3 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ui 2017-03-10 10:20:40 -08:00
Seth Alves
494b602d4c Merge pull request #9850 from druiz17/toolbar-MIA-afetr-snapshot
toolbar becomes visible after taking a snapshot
2017-03-10 10:20:01 -08:00
Seth Alves
cef4c988c4 Merge pull request #9835 from druiz17/toolbar-window-dont-close
Close toolbar windows when reloading scripts
2017-03-10 10:19:07 -08:00
Seth Alves
d792559d9a have edit.js resend properties of selected entity to entityProperties.js once it's ready 2017-03-10 09:59:23 -08:00
Dante Ruiz
d54005b62e no more duplicate snapshot buttons after taking reloading scripts 2017-03-10 00:17:44 +00:00
Dante Ruiz
c6c0c6d382 toolbar becomes visible after taking a snapshot 2017-03-09 22:54:22 +00:00
Anthony J. Thibault
d8f04d90a7 Merge branch 'master' into feature/can-touch-this 2017-03-09 14:24:10 -08:00
Anthony J. Thibault
6f53aaed5c Small simplification of building stylusTarget list. 2017-03-09 14:04:13 -08:00
druiz17
0069569e96 Merge branch 'tablet-ui' into 21197 2017-03-09 09:31:15 -08:00
Seth Alves
023b01814e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ui-quick-summon-1 2017-03-09 09:16:37 -08:00
druiz17
007ed9fe81 Merge pull request #9836 from druiz17/2-tablets-fix
Fixed having more than one tablet when reloading scripts
2017-03-09 09:13:14 -08:00
Anthony J. Thibault
1acc5ea760 Finger now points when near tablet + deadspot added when touching the tablet 2017-03-08 19:03:56 -08:00
Dante Ruiz
2a275a4f4b removed tab at the end of word 2017-03-09 00:15:02 +00:00
Seth Alves
9435c58c2c Merge branch 'tablet-ui-edit-js' of github.com:sethalves/hifi into tablet-ui-quick-summon-1 2017-03-08 16:10:38 -08:00
Dante Ruiz
b878f164fb minimize diff again 2017-03-09 00:10:38 +00:00
Dante Ruiz
f6d799c048 minimize diff 2017-03-09 00:09:32 +00:00
Dante Ruiz
561bd27c38 minimize diff 2017-03-09 00:08:50 +00:00
Dante Ruiz
5f7a0ea8fc Close tablet when switching form HMD to desktop and vice versa 2017-03-09 00:05:26 +00:00
Seth Alves
6aac2eb338 for overlay tablets, precreate them so that they show up quickly when summoned 2017-03-08 15:31:24 -08:00
Seth Alves
de2dd7383d didn't need invis flag, after all 2017-03-08 15:30:49 -08:00
Dante Ruiz
ce105e0329 fix double tablets when reloading scripts 2017-03-08 22:21:57 +00:00
Dante Ruiz
881213259d Merge branch 'master' of github.com:highfidelity/hifi into toolbar-window-dont-close 2017-03-08 21:44:20 +00:00
Dante Ruiz
59b4fa5fd7 Close toolbar windows when scripts are reloaded 2017-03-08 21:44:04 +00:00
Seth Alves
371c20ee25 hide tablet by making it not visible rather than destroying it 2017-03-08 10:33:59 -08:00
Seth Alves
66d44ac6f0 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ui-edit-js 2017-03-08 09:26:51 -08:00
Seth Alves
a67f8ac0ed Merge pull request #9807 from Menithal/21166-remove-limit
#9761 Cloneable Improvement
2017-03-08 07:15:06 -08:00
David Rowe
950f91965d Merge branch 'tablet-ui-edit-js' into 21197 2017-03-08 17:35:58 +13:00
Anthony J. Thibault
836c701cb3 More accurate and responsive stylus and finger touching.
The algorithm used to detect when and where the stylus or finger is touching the tablet has been improved.

* hovering the finger/stylus over the surface of the tablet should cause buttons to highlight.
* flicking or using the stylus like a drum stick, should more accurately click buttons on the tablet.
* stabbing the tablet quickly, should also more accurately trigger button presses.
* moving the hand/stylus from behind the tablet should be less likely to cause press events.
2017-03-07 18:19:32 -08:00
Seth Alves
b938579598 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ui-edit-js 2017-03-07 11:42:44 -08:00
Andrew Meadows
1e9623e2f2 Merge pull request #9813 from druiz17/multipule-audio-fix
removed duplicated audio devices
2017-03-07 10:00:48 -08:00
Seth Alves
f594689fa8 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ui-edit-js 2017-03-07 09:24:50 -08:00
Dante Ruiz
fc65723d68 corrected removing duplicate devices 2017-03-06 22:14:20 +00:00
Seth Alves
4886f1cbfc don't run stylus-on-overlay code unless the overlay is a web3d overlay 2017-03-06 12:38:19 -08:00
Brad Hefta-Gaub
38668b6ce5 Merge pull request #9812 from sethalves/dont-auto-ungrab-overlays
don't automatically unhook overlays from hands unless they were grabbable overlays
2017-03-06 12:32:18 -08:00
Thijs Wenker
6ded937b25 Merge pull request #9809 from Menithal/21201
WL#21201 Snap-together Magnetic blocks
2017-03-06 21:30:53 +01:00
David Rowe
09ecb12510 Merge branch 'tablet-ui-edit-js' into 21197
# Conflicts:
#	interface/src/ui/overlays/Web3DOverlay.cpp
2017-03-07 08:59:40 +13:00
Seth Alves
27066e89a6 Merge branch 'dont-auto-ungrab-overlays' of github.com:sethalves/hifi into tablet-ui-edit-js 2017-03-06 11:46:19 -08:00
Seth Alves
a2d2c41f02 remove debug print 2017-03-06 11:45:49 -08:00
Seth Alves
08e2e421e4 Merge branch '21199' of github.com:ctrlaltdavid/hifi into tablet-ui-edit-js 2017-03-06 11:08:27 -08:00
Seth Alves
eb47db4441 Merge branch 'dont-auto-ungrab-overlays' of github.com:sethalves/hifi into tablet-ui-edit-js 2017-03-06 11:07:22 -08:00
Dante Ruiz
b6671d92c8 removed duplicated audio devices 2017-03-06 18:46:57 +00:00
Seth Alves
6ac576c9e6 Merge branch 'master' of github.com:highfidelity/hifi into dont-auto-ungrab-overlays 2017-03-06 10:43:43 -08:00
Seth Alves
19a31d7630 don't automatically unhook overlays from hands unless they were grabbable overlays 2017-03-06 10:15:53 -08:00